[Dynamics of the structural transformations of parietal bone autotransplant]
Abstract:
Histomorphological studies carried out during 1 month after autotransplantation of the parietal bone into a facial skull defect showed necrosis of osteocytes, contents of bone marrow spaces, and feeding channels in the transplanted autobone. During this period and later loose connective tissue grows into them. As a result of resorption of osseous matter, new bone cavities are formed and the lumina of feeding channels are dilated. Simultaneously a new bone substance, containing viable osteocytes, appears on their walls. Gradually the autobone graft is replaced by newly formed bone tissue.
